Pain Points Analysis
Utah's solar market faces big pains now. We used web searches for fresh data on trends. Here are seven key pains. We explain them simply.
Big Rate Hikes from Rocky Mountain Power: They got a 4.7% hike in April 2025. They first asked for 30.6% over two years, then cut to 18.1% in 2024. The commission said no to more in July 2025, calling big asks "offensive." This adds $17 or more to monthly bills. Orem families pay extra due to fuel costs.
ITC Deadline Stress: The 30% solar tax credit ends December 31, 2025. Projects must finish by then for full perks. This causes a rush and worry. Utah solar growth may slow without it. Folks in Springville fear missing 30% off batteries.
Long Battery Wait Times: Solar battery installs take 3-6 months in Utah for 2025. Supply issues add 4-6 weeks in peaks. Orem residents can't get quick fixes amid demand.
High Competitor Prices: Average solar costs $2.61 per watt in Utah, about $13,074 for 5 kW. Powerwall 3 runs $24,000-$26,000 from others. EG4 options cost $5,000-$8,000 plus fees. Salem homeowners pay double without deals.
Frequent Blackouts: Utah County had over 19,000 lose power in a 2024 June event. Wildfire cuts rose from zero in 2023. Without batteries, homes in Santaquin stay dark.
Net Metering Shifts: Rocky Mountain Power credits extra solar at low rates. Time-based pricing moves use to off-peak, but changes could cut more. Orem users lose out with higher base fees.
Solar Job Risks: ITC end could cost 300,000 U.S. solar jobs. Utah firms may shut or raise prices. Payson families fear lost warranties.
